Transaction 4a128e29c763de24693591f281e691b737ab7e80c342fc254baeb144af6ec743
1 Input
1 Output
-
4a128e29c763de24693591f281e691b737ab7e80c342fc254baeb144af6ec743:0
- value
- 17068915
- script pubkey
- OP_0 OP_PUSHBYTES_20 84a77c01991cfc0569e8cb0dddbab12171a808ae
- address
- bc1qsjnhcqvern7q260gevxamw43y9c6sz9w9ae99u